Secure the tapes of the zipper in the clamps of the testing machine with the edges of the jaws parallel to and approximately 3 mm (½ in.) from the sides of the bottom stop. which shall be centrally located in the clamps as shown in Fig. 6. Apply the load until the stop pulls apart, until the tape breaks, or until failure of some other kind occurs. Record the nature of the failure and the load at failure to the nearest 2.2 N (0.5 lbf) for values under 222 N (50 lhfl and to the nearest 4.4 N (1 lbf) for values of 222 N and over.
22.5 Bouoiia 5top Holding, Stringer Sepai-a lion —Position the slider body so that its mouth is against the bottom of the stop to he tested. In the case of the entering type bottom stop. position the slider at the point where normally checked in its free movement. Set the opposing clamps of the testing machine approximately 76 mm (3 in.) apart and secure one of the stringers in the upper clamp and the other in the lower clamp of the tensile testing machine approximately 76 mm apart. Secure the stringers in the upper and lower clamps of the testing machine with the slider body positioned along the axis of the clamps and midway between them as shown in Fig. 7. Apply an increasing load until the stop pulls off, until the tape breaks, or until failure of some other kind occurs. Record the nature of the failure and load at failure to the nearest 2.2 N (0.5 lbf) for values under 222 N (50 lbf) and to the nearest 4.4 N lbf for values 222 N and over.

30.2 Fixed Retainer Pull-Off—Secure the fixture (Fig. 10) in the upper clamp of the testing machine. Separate the two stringers and position the fixed retainer on the upper edges of the slot of the fixture and, with an approximate 76 mm (3 in.) distance between the lower edge of the fixed retainer and the upper edge of the lower clamp, secure the stringer in the lower clamp as shown in Fig. II. Apply an increasing load until the retainer pulls off, until the tape breaks, or until failure of some other kind occurs. Record the nature of the failure and load at failure to the nearest 2.2 N (0.5 lhfl fhr values under 222 N (50 lhfl and to the nearest 4.4 N (1 lhf) for values 222 N and over.
